I need help with an issue I have, the case is that we run Microsoft SQL server that runs maintanance plans each night. These jobs create a .bak file with format databasename_db_%year%date%time%.bak. I have read through many examples in the forum about getting the newest file and testing. But I must be honest, I am not a programmer and do not understand the scripts. What I would like to accomplish is to read the files in a directory and check that the newest file is not older that 1440 mins (24hours). This will give a good controll that the job is working.

You might not need to check the filename, just the date of creating of the newest file. In the folder there will only be backup jobs containing that database.

I think, you may use "Count files" test method, which offers "Count files older than NN min" and "Count files newer than NN min" options:
